Frequently Asked Questions About Windows in Cave Junction

Get answers to common questions about windows services in Cave Junction, Oregon.

1What is the typical cost range for a full window replacement in a Cave Junction home?

For a standard home in Cave Junction, full window replacement typically ranges from $600 to $1,200 per window installed, depending on the window type, size, and material. This includes the cost of energy-efficient double-pane vinyl or wood-clad windows, which are highly recommended for our local climate featuring cool, wet winters and warm, dry summers. The final price is also influenced by the unique challenges of older homes in the area, such as potential rot or out-of-square frames, which a reputable local installer will assess during a free, in-home estimate.

2Are there specific energy efficiency recommendations for windows in Cave Junction's climate?

Absolutely. Given Oregon's energy code requirements and Cave Junction's temperature swings, we strongly recommend windows with a low U-factor (for insulation) and a low Solar Heat Gain Coefficient (SHGC) to manage summer sun. Double-pane windows with Low-E coatings and argon gas fill are the standard for effectively balancing comfort and energy savings year-round. This is crucial for managing heating costs in our damp, chilly winters and maintaining cool interiors during our sunny, hot summers.

3How long does a professional window installation project usually take in Cave Junction?

For a typical single-family home, a professional crew can complete a full-house window replacement (10-15 windows) in 1-3 days, barring unforeseen structural issues. Scheduling is key; the ideal installation periods in Cave Junction are late spring through early fall to avoid our rainy season, which can cause delays and complicate exterior sealing work. A trustworthy local installer will provide a clear timeline and prepare for potential weather-related adjustments common in our region.

4What should I look for when choosing a window installation contractor in the Cave Junction area?

Prioritize contractors who are licensed, bonded, and insured in Oregon and have specific experience with the structural styles common in our area, from older ranches to newer builds. Check for strong local references and reviews, and ensure they pull the required City of Cave Junction or Josephine County building permits, which verify the work meets state and local codes. A provider familiar with our local suppliers and weather patterns will ensure a smoother process and a product suited to our environment.
